Abstract

Current diagnostic alternatives for lesions of the small intestine are sometimes insufficient. Peroperative enteroscopy is presented as a useful method to identify and treat intestinal polyposis and angiodysplasias that can not be found by other methods. This technique was used on two patients. In both cases, this procedure was helpful and the appropriate treatment successfully completed.
